New quartet at Bristol

A new quartet of players helps boost the ranks at Bristol East & Kingswood

Bristol East and Kingswood logo
 

Bristol East & Kingswood Band has welcome four new players to the band.

Principal cornet

Chris Vickers, who is studying music at Bristol University, takes over the principal cornet seat from Andrew Campbell, who has left.

MD Ben Vleminckx told 4BR: "It's fantastic to have a player of Chris's calibre in the band and I'm looking forward to working with him."

Chris added: "I'm looking forward to playing in a brass band, chasing the elusive cornet sound and keeping up with the bass team at the bar!"

Students

Meanwhile, university students Katie Eddy and Lauren Hodge join on solo cornet and solo horn from Pendennis Brass, Falmouth, and Camborne Junior Contesting respectively.

The MD added: "It’s great to have a strong player like Katie in the cornet section and to work with Lauren again."

Katie said: "I’m excited to be part of a band again and the friendly and welcoming atmosphere has made this very easy."

Laureen added: "I’m also excited about being given the opportunity to play with the band and looking forward to successful concerts and contests in the near future."

Tuba

Finally, Andy joins on Bb Bass and returns to playing after a 15 year contesting break.

MD Ben Vleminckx added: "We have added real experience to the band here with Andy and its great he has chosen the band to make his comeback."

Andy added: "I’m looking forward to being a member of a hard working band with lots of summer engagements and contests in the calendar."

We welcome these recruits and look forward to enjoying the essential difference they will make to the sound and capability of the bandBand Chairman Tom Doughty

Pleased

Band Chairman Tom Doughty is also very pleased: "We welcome these recruits and look forward to enjoying the essential difference they will make to the sound and capability of the band as it moves forward to bigger and better things, under Ben's enthusiastic direction."
